2025 Cleveland Ace Racer 400 vs 2015 Royal Enfield Classic 500

The Cleveland Ace Racer 400 records a lower weight than the Royal Enfield Classic 500. The Royal Enfield Classic 500 has the advantage in recorded torque and displacement where both recorded values are available.

Torque

The Royal Enfield Classic 500 records 41.3 Nm of torque, 11.3 Nm (37.7%) more than the Cleveland Ace Racer 400 at 30 Nm.

Weight

The Cleveland Ace Racer 400 records a lower wet weight of 175 kg, 15 kg less than the Royal Enfield Classic 500 at 190 kg.

Displacement

The Royal Enfield Classic 500 records 499 cc, 102 cc (25.7%) more than the Cleveland Ace Racer 400 at 397 cc.
